dineshv wrote:
> I want to display images on a web page.  All the (*.jpg) image files
> are in the /static/ folder.  The following code:
> 
>> imagePath = 'C:/blahBlah/static/'
>> imageName = 'moreBlah.jpg'
>> print open(imagePath + imageName, "rb").read()
> 
> prints out gibberish.
> 
> Also tried:
> 
>> imagePath = '/static/'
> 
> and that results in a File Not Found error.
> 
> Any thoughts?

The "gibberish" you see is binary data interpreted as html in whatever 
encoding it might guess. You need to send the correct mime-type 
("content-type: image/jpeg" in this case) for the browser to know that 
it is a jpeg encoded image.

b^4

--~--~---------~--~----~------------~-------~--~----~
You received this message because you are subscribed to the Google Groups 
"web.py" group.
To post to this group, send email to [email protected]
To unsubscribe from this group, send email to [EMAIL PROTECTED]
For more options, visit this group at http://groups.google.com/group/webpy?hl=en
-~----------~----~----~----~------~----~------~--~---

Reply via email to